ERROR: Password not changed
Possible Cause:
The old password does not match the stored password; the new password is invalid; or the new
password and the repeated new password do not match.
ERROR: Unknown error
Possible Cause:
While attempting to parse a command line an error of unknown origin occurred.
ERROR: Bad or missing configuration file
Possible Cause:
The specified configuration file is not present on the system. It is possible that the file name is
incorrectly spelled.
ERROR: Invalid number
Possible Cause:
The specified number is not a valid hex number starting with a ‘$’ or a valid decimal number starting
with a digit.
ERROR: Invalid device specifier
Possible Cause:
The device specifier is invalid since it is not of the format ‘1a’, where ‘1’ represents the slot number

ERROR: Invalid drive specifier
Possible Cause:
The specified drive letter does not indicate a drive avaliable to the system.
ERROR: Security information not changed
Possible Cause:
The new user id is invalid. The new password is invalid; or the new password and the repeated new
password do not match.
ERROR: Unable to update security information
Possible Cause:
The CMOS write error failed when updating the security information.
